France, ‘Buakaw Banchamek’ joins in teaching Muay Thai skills, creating a trend for Muay Thai in the 2024 Olympic Games. Follow along with Mr. Somyot Dangyuan, reporting from Paris, France, in the ‘Scouting In Paris Games 2024’ segment.

After the International Federation of Muay Thai Associations (IFMA) together with Buakaw Banchamek, a famous Thai boxer, and Jimmy Vienot, a famous French boxer, opened the teaching of Muay Thai skills to a large number of interested foreign Muay Thai families at the Teddy Reiner Arena in Paris, France, which is one of the activities to bring the sport of “Muay Thai” to be shown in a virtual competition during the 2024 Olympic Games “Paris Games”, it was lively along with the awarding of training certificates from IFMA, with representatives from the International Olympic Committee (IOC) joining as observers.

After learning the skills and receiving the certificate, many foreign Muay Thai boxers lined up to get autographs and take photos with Buakaw Banchamek as souvenirs. ‘Bu
akaw’ revealed that he was proud to be considered an idol in Muay Thai in the eyes of foreigners. He considered it a good thing that inspired him and made him determined to train in Muay Thai. The 2024 Olympics is the first step in promoting Muay Thai during the Olympic Games. If Muay Thai is considered to be included in the Olympic Games in the future, Thai people will be happy and proud.

Meanwhile, at the Olympic House in Paris, there was a signing ceremony for the promotion of Muay Thai between IFMA led by Dr. Sakchai Tapsuwan as the president, Stefan Fox, IFMA Secretary-General and Prince Abdulaziz bin Turki Al Faisal, President of the Islamic Solidarity Sports Association, together with the President of the Peruvian Olympic Committee and the President of the Bahrain Olympic Committee to support and promote Muay Thai by including Muay Thai in the future Muslim Unity Games. IFMA will support the organization of the competition and referees according to IFMA standards.
